Primary Diffuse Large B-Cell Lymphoma Localized to the Lacrimal Sac: A Case Presentation and Review of the Literature

Figure 1

Orbits MRI. Right orbit: there is a 4.1 × 1.9 × 3.5 cm mass in the medial aspect of the right orbit. The mass displaces the medial rectus laterally and the globe anteriorly and laterally. The optic chiasm is normal in appearance. There is no suprasellar or parasellar mass. The pituitary gland is within normal limits in size.
